drove to town today. Neither tach or volt gauge was working and the light on the left of the fuel gauge was on.

Is there a wire somewhere that might have fell off?

I checked the belt. I can feel it so it's still there. Been meaning to change it but looks really hard to get to.

checked with meter at battery. 13.5 w/ car off & 14.3 running
